FTC Penguin height corrected customized
the too tall FTC Penguin bugged me, along with the off model vest so I fixed those two errors by transplanting the head and most of the clothes to a shorter teen body padded out to make him look like a shorter adult.
also my Catwoman transplanted to a better body and redid the belt to sit lower on her hips.

Re: FTC Penguin height corrected customized
Arrrgh! I couldn't stand it! I just shortened my Penguin's legs.
A few months ago, shortening some Laurel and Hardy legs, to make other customs, was very hard, because their legs were solid. Penguin's legs are hollow (just like real birds!), so I simply cut a chunk from each calf with a bread knife, rejoined the pieces with quickset putty, and shortened the hems on the black trousers. Done!

Re: FTC Penguin height corrected customized
next time you order from FTC get a teen body, it works well, I used the forearms from the original Penguin so the jacket and shirt arms don't need altering. I did have to take up the pants, I may replace them as they are inaccurate, too. Wrong color, should be a very dark grey.
